How to become a Department Network Administrator (DNA)?

0

To become a DNA, the department network or systems administrator should contact the university hostmaster@osu.edu. Each subnet must have a Primary DNA, a Secondary DNA or a Secondary contact. Enterprise Networking only supports the university core network, and services as a result DNAs are responsible installing and maintaining their local network infrastructure. For more information about being a DNA and the services offered to DNAs please review our DNA website. Being a DNA is an important function and OIT has some Minimum Expectations to be a DNA.
